百度与主流搜索平台技术对比:2023年差距分析与优化路径

一、搜索算法效率与结果相关性差异

1.1 基础检索性能对比

主流搜索平台普遍采用分布式图计算架构,支持万亿级网页的实时索引更新,其核心优势在于通过动态负载均衡技术,将索引更新延迟控制在秒级。例如,某平台通过分片存储与并行计算结合,实现单节点日均处理10亿级文档更新,而部分平台仍依赖传统批量更新模式,导致新内容收录延迟较高。

在检索结果排序方面,主流方案通过强化学习模型动态调整权重参数,结合用户实时行为数据(如点击、停留时长)优化排序策略。某平台曾公开其排序模型包含超过200个特征维度,涵盖内容质量、时效性、用户偏好等因子,而部分平台特征维度较少,导致长尾内容曝光不足。

1.2 语义理解深度差异

自然语言处理(NLP)能力是搜索结果相关性的关键。主流平台通过预训练大模型(如千亿参数级Transformer架构)实现多轮对话理解、上下文关联等功能。例如,某平台支持“先搜‘北京天气’,再问‘明天呢’”的连续查询,而部分平台仍需用户重新输入完整关键词。

技术实现上,主流方案采用多任务学习框架,将语义匹配、实体识别、意图分类等任务联合训练。以下为示意性代码结构:

  1. class MultiTaskModel(nn.Module):
  2. def __init__(self):
  3. super().__init__()
  4. self.shared_encoder = TransformerEncoder() # 共享语义编码层
  5. self.task_heads = {
  6. 'semantic_match': DenseLayer(768, 1), # 语义匹配头
  7. 'entity_recognition': CRFLayer(768, 100) # 实体识别头
  8. }
  9. def forward(self, input_ids):
  10. embeddings = self.shared_encoder(input_ids)
  11. return {task: head(embeddings) for task, head in self.task_heads.items()}

部分平台若未构建此类联合学习框架,可能导致语义理解碎片化。

二、多模态与垂直场景支持能力

2.1 图像与视频搜索技术

主流平台通过多模态预训练模型(如CLIP架构)实现文本-图像的跨模态检索,支持“以图搜图”“视频关键帧定位”等功能。某平台公开其图像检索准确率达92%(Top-10),而部分平台若未部署类似技术,可能依赖传统特征提取(如SIFT),导致复杂场景下识别率下降。

2.2 垂直领域优化策略

在医疗、法律等垂直领域,主流平台通过构建领域知识图谱提升结果专业性。例如,某平台医疗搜索结果会关联权威文献、药品说明书等结构化数据,而部分平台若缺乏领域数据治理,可能返回泛化内容。

技术实现上,垂直优化需经历三阶段:

  1. 数据采集:爬取权威网站、对接机构数据库
  2. 知识建模:定义实体关系(如“疾病-症状-治疗方案”)
  3. 检索增强:在排序阶段优先展示知识图谱关联内容

三、开发者生态与工具链支持

3.1 开放平台能力对比

主流搜索平台提供完整的开发者工具链,包括:

  • API服务:支持高并发调用(如QPS 10万+)
  • SDK集成:覆盖Python/Java/Go等多语言
  • 调试工具:实时日志分析、效果对比看板

某平台曾公开其API平均响应时间低于80ms,而部分平台若未优化底层网络架构(如采用gRPC替代RESTful),可能导致延迟较高。

3.2 定制化开发支持

针对企业级需求,主流平台提供可配置的排序策略、结果过滤规则等。例如,某平台允许通过JSON配置文件调整结果权重:

  1. {
  2. "ranking_rules": [
  3. {"field": "freshness", "weight": 0.3},
  4. {"field": "authority", "weight": 0.5}
  5. ],
  6. "filter_conditions": [
  7. {"field": "language", "operator": "=", "value": "zh-CN"}
  8. ]
  9. }

部分平台若缺乏此类灵活配置接口,可能增加企业二次开发成本。

四、性能优化与架构设计建议

4.1 索引层优化方向

  • 分片策略:按文档类型、更新频率分片,减少单节点压力
  • 缓存机制:对热门查询结果采用多级缓存(内存+SSD)
  • 压缩算法:使用Zstandard等压缩索引数据,降低存储成本

4.2 排序层优化实践

  • 特征工程:增加用户画像、设备信息等上下文特征
  • 模型轻量化:通过知识蒸馏将大模型压缩为适合在线服务的版本
  • A/B测试框架:建立灰度发布系统,对比不同排序策略效果

4.3 生态建设路径

  • 开放数据集:发布领域标注数据集,吸引开发者参与
  • 插件市场:支持第三方开发搜索增强插件(如学术引用检查)
  • 社区运营:定期举办技术沙龙、黑客马拉松等活动

五、总结与展望

2023年搜索技术的竞争核心在于多模态理解、垂直场景深耕与开发者生态构建。百度若需缩小差距,可重点投入:

  1. 预训练模型研发:提升语义理解深度
  2. 实时索引架构:降低新内容收录延迟
  3. 开发者工具完善:降低集成门槛

未来,随着生成式AI与搜索技术的融合,如何平衡结果准确性与创造性,将成为新的技术制高点。开发者需持续关注模型压缩、边缘计算等方向,以适应搜索场景的多元化需求。